Who needs the Minnesota Department of Agriculture:

01
Farmers and agricultural producers: The Minnesota Department of Agriculture is a valuable resource for farmers in the state. It provides information and guidance on various aspects of agriculture, including crop production, livestock management, and farm regulations. Farmers can also access programs and services offered by the department to support and enhance their operations.
02
Food processors and manufacturers: Food processing businesses in Minnesota may need to work with the Minnesota Department of Agriculture to comply with food safety regulations, obtain licenses and permits, and ensure product quality. The department offers inspection services, certifications, and resources to help food businesses navigate the regulatory landscape and maintain compliance.
03
Consumers and the general public: The Minnesota Department of Agriculture plays a crucial role in protecting the interests of consumers. It ensures the safety and quality of agricultural products, enforces food safety standards, and regulates aspects related to pesticides, fertilizers, and other agricultural inputs. Consumers can benefit from the department's resources and information to make informed choices about the food they consume and the agricultural practices in the state.

The Minnesota Department of Agriculture is a state government agency responsible for promoting and protecting agriculture in Minnesota.
Farmers, agricultural businesses, and other entities involved in agriculture in Minnesota are required to file with the Minnesota Department of Agriculture.
To fill out the Minnesota Department of Agriculture forms, you can visit their website or contact their office for assistance.
The purpose of the Minnesota Department of Agriculture is to support and regulate the agriculture industry in the state, ensure food safety, and promote sustainable practices.
The information that must be reported on the Minnesota Department of Agriculture forms may include details on crops grown, livestock raised, pesticides used, and more.
